Unraveling The Feline Gustatory System: Understanding Selective Feeding

Cats, renowned for their fussy eating habits, possess a complex gustatory system that greatly influences their food preferences. Unlike humans or dogs, felines have a significantly reduced ability to taste sweetness, a consequence of genetic changes that occurred during their evolutionary journey. This shortage of sweet taste receptor function, coupled with a heightened sensitivity to amino acids and umami flavors, explains why they prefer protein-rich diets and often avoid foods with a sugary profile. Furthermore, their olfactory senses play a critical role in food acceptance, with aroma being far more important than taste itself; a meal might be attractive based solely on its scent. Consequently, understanding this unique sensory biology is crucial for formulating palatable and nutritionally sufficient feline diets and for addressing cases of selective eating behavior.

Exploring Why Your Cat Declines Food: A Physiological Perspective

Beyond simple pickiness, a cat’s sudden food rejection often signals a deeper, physiological concern. From a purely biological perspective, diminished appetite, or food aversion, can be a manifestation of various underlying conditions. Dental diseases, such as tooth decay, can make eating painful and lead to a feline’s hesitation to eat. Gastrointestinal disorders, including IBD, can disrupt nutrient uptake and further discourage food intake. Furthermore, metabolic conditions, like hyperthyroidism or kidney impairment, frequently alter a cat’s body chemistry, impacting their desire for food. Even seemingly minor illnesses, such as a respiratory condition, can reduce appetite due to feeling unwell. Therefore, persistent food rejection warrants a veterinary examination to rule out any underlying physiological causes and ensure your feline friend receives the necessary care.

Investigating Decoding the Picky Eater: A Scientific Look at Cat Palatability

The feline reputation as a picky eater isn't simply anecdotal; it's rooted in complex neurological factors. Scientists are now examining far beyond just "spoiled" behavior to understand what makes a food palatable to a cat. It's a combination of olfactory sensitivity—their sense of smell is paramount—and taste receptor preferences. Unlike humans, cats have a reduced ability to taste sweetness, but they are extraordinarily sensitive to amino acids, volatile organic compounds released from food, and texture. Furthermore, their innate predispositions, prior experiences, and even the food’s presentation can dramatically affect acceptance. Ongoing investigations are revealing the specific molecular compounds that trigger a "like" response and identifying ways to enhance the palatability of cat food, ultimately aiming to address the frustrating challenge of feline finickiness.
